A Great Indoor Playground
Year-round Family Fun.
Bingemans has been a fixture in Kitchener, Ontario, for a long time. "We have had more than 66 years of continuous service," says General Manager Mark Bingeman, a grandson of founder Marshall Bingeman. The growing enterprise with six divisions is situated on land that was once the founder's 170-acre hobby farm. Five divisions are related to food and events: Bingemans is the largest off-premise caterer in southern Ontario, and also has facilities for meetings and conferences on its property. In addition, they operate sports arena food concessions, and have full-service vending and cafeteria management divisions.
Raising Profile and Productivity
Mott Manufacturing's attractive new plant reflects its new direction
When Bill Stover and Ed Seegmiller acquired Mott Manufacturing recently, the company was almost 60 years old. Founded in the 1930s, the Brantford, Ontario, firm had evolved through a number of owners and product lines to emerge as a manufacturer of steel kitchen cabinets and laboratory furniture.
Building Better Resources for Hope
The Hahn-Hufford Center of Hope is able to offer even more to its clients
Since 1972, the Hahn-Hufford Center of Hope in Piqua, Ohio, had been doing good work in unsuitable facilities. The center’s rehabilitation programs— which provide physical therapy to people disabled by stroke, birth trauma, brain injury, autism and similar maladies—were housed most recently in an old warehouse.
